Safest Way To Delete Hard Drive Data
What is the most sure shot way of ensuring your data is not accessible to others
when you are selling your hard drive? Can formatting a hard drive rid it of all the data that was once saved in it? So what can a user do to ensure that his vital data doesn't fall in wrong hands? These and similar questions crop in the mind of a user when he/she is at the verge of selling his/her old hard drive. But the answer to these questions is very simple! Overwrite either all the data or that particular data files with data that is of no use. This process is known as
hard drive wipeBut the question that arises here is, what is the need to overwrite, when a simple process of formatting is available?
This is because when some data is deleted, or when a system is formatted, only the storage location information of file(s) is deleted. The files themselves remain intact, and need to be overwritten to become completely inaccessible. No process of deletion can remove the files, until a file eraser software that overwrites the files is run. These data eraser software use special algorithms to overwrite all the data that was saved in your hard drive.
Once your files, and data is overwritten, no recovery process can ever reclaim it, thus ensuring that the information can not be misused by anybody. This process not only deletes data, but also any kinds of virus, or any malicious applications from the drive. Normally, a hard drive wipe software performs more than one pass to overwrite data to ensure complete inaccessibility of everything that was once stored in the drive.
